oracle中chr含义

CHR(10)和 CHR(13)——在oracle都为换行

chr(32)——表示空格

DECLARE

v_a VARCHAR2(255);

v_b VARCHAR2(255);

BEGIN

SELECT 'a' || chr(9) || 'b' INTO v_b FROM dual;

v_a := 'a  b'; --a和b之间是tab键

dbms_output.put_line(v_b);

dbms_output.put_line(v_a);

IFv_a = v_b THEN

dbms_output.put_line('v_a与v_b相等');

END IF;

END;

输出结果表明两者不相等

DECLARE

v_a VARCHAR2(255);

v_b VARCHAR2(255);

BEGIN

SELECT 'a' || chr(9) || 'b' INTO v_b FROM dual;

v_a := 'a b'; --a和 b之间是空格

dbms_output.put_line(v_b);

dbms_output.put_line(v_a);

IFv_a = v_b THEN

dbms_output.put_line('v_a与v_b相等');

END IF;

END;

输出结果表明两者不相等

Chr函数 返回:返回 String,其中包含有与指定的字符代码相关的字符。

Chr("0") 为0的字符

Chr("1")

Chr("2")

Chr("3")

Chr("4")

Chr("5")

Chr("6")

Chr("7") 响铃

Chr("8") 回格

Chr("9") tab(水平制表符)

Chr("10") 换行

Chr("11") tab(垂直制表符)

Chr("12") 换页

Chr("13") 回车 chr(13)&chr(10) 回车和换行的组合

Chr("14")

Chr("15")

Chr("16")

Chr("17")

Chr("18")

Chr("19")

Chr("20")

Chr("21")

Chr("22")

Chr("23")

Chr("24")

Chr("25")

Chr("26") 结束 End

Chr("27") 脱离 Pause break

Chr("28")

Chr("29")

Chr("30")

Chr("31")

Chr("32") 空格 SPACE

Chr("33") !

Chr("34") "

Chr("35") #

Chr("36") $

Chr("37") %

Chr("38") &

Chr("39") ’

Chr("40") (

Chr("41") )

Chr("42") *

Chr("43") +

Chr("44") ,

Chr("45") -

Chr("46") .

Chr("47") /

Chr("48") 0

Chr("49") 1

Chr("50") 2

Chr("51") 3

Chr("52") 4

Chr("53") 5

Chr("54") 6

Chr("55") 7

Chr("56") 8

Chr("57") 9

Chr("58") :

Chr("59") ;

Chr("60") <

Chr("61") =

Chr("62") >

Chr("63") ?

Chr("64") @

Chr("65") A

Chr("66") B

Chr("67") C

Chr("68") D

Chr("69") E

Chr("70") F

Chr("71") G

Chr("72") H

Chr("73") I

Chr("74") J

Chr("75") K

Chr("76") L

Chr("77") M

Chr("78") N

Chr("79") O

Chr("80") P

Chr("81") Q

Chr("82") R

Chr("83") S

Chr("84") T

Chr("85") U

Chr("86") V

Chr("87") W

Chr("88") X

Chr("89") Y

Chr("90") Z

Chr("91") [

Chr("92") \

Chr("92") \

Chr("93") ]

Chr("94") ^

Chr("95") _

Chr("96") `

Chr("97") a

Chr("98") b

Chr("99") c

Chr("100") d

Chr("101") e

Chr("102") f

Chr("103") g

Chr("104") h

Chr("105")i

Chr("106") j

Chr("107") k

Chr("108") l

Chr("109") m

Chr("110") n

Chr("111") o

Chr("112") p

Chr("113") q

Chr("114") r

Chr("115") s

Chr("116") t

Chr("117") u

Chr("118") v

Chr("119") w

Chr("120") x

Chr("121")y

Chr("122") z

Chr("123") {

Chr("124") |

Chr("125") }

Chr("126") ~

Chr("127")

Chr("128")

Chr("129")

Chr("130")

Chr("131")

Chr("132")

有个简单的查看方法,打开记事本,如要查看“Chr("119") w”,可以按下Alt+119

(先按住Alt不放,然后输入数字,输完后在放开)

注意:数字一定要从旁边的数字键盘输入,否则无效

【Oracle】Oracle中chr()的含义的更多相关文章

  1. oracle存储过程中%type的含义

    转: oracle存储过程中%type的含义 2018-11-07 11:43:56 lizhi_ma 阅读数 1361更多 分类专栏: 数据库   版权声明:本文为博主原创文章,遵循CC 4.0 B ...

  2. sybase数据库和oracle数据库中字段中含有换行符的解决办法

    最近在做数据库从sybase到oracle的迁移工作,sybase数据库表bcp导出后,通过sqlldr导入到oracle数据库,然后oracle数据库通过spool按照sybase数据库bcp的格式 ...

  3. Oracle Statspack报告中各项指标含义详解~~学习性能必看!!!

    Oracle Statspack报告中各项指标含义详解~~学习性能必看!!! Data Buffer Hit Ratio#<#90# 数据块在数据缓冲区中的命中率,通常应该在90%以上,否则考虑 ...

  4. oracle中的符号含义

    1.Oracle数据库存储过程中:=是什么意思?答:赋值的意思.举例:str := 'abcd';将字符串abcd赋值给变量str. 2.oracle 存储过程中的 := 和=有什么区别?答::= 是 ...

  5. 关于Oracle GoldenGate中Extract的checkpoint的理解 转载

    什么是checkpoint? 在Oracle 数据库中checkpoint的意思是将内存中的脏数据强制写入到磁盘的事件,其作用是保持内存中的数据与磁盘上的数据一致.SCN是用来描述该事件发生的准确的时 ...

  6. Oracle函数之chr

    chr()函数将ASCII码转换为字符:字符 –> ASCII码:ascii()函数将字符转换为ASCII码:ASCII码 –> 字符: 在oracle中chr()函数和ascii()是一 ...

  7. 盘点 Oracle 11g 中新特性带来的10大性能影响

    Oracle的任何一个新版本,总是会带来大量引人瞩目的新特性,但是往往在这些新特性引入之初,首先引起的是一些麻烦,因为对于新技术的不了解.因为对于旧环境的不适应,从Oracle产品到技术服务运维,总是 ...

  8. Oracle Spatial中SDO_Geometry说明

    Oracle Spatial中SDO_Geometry说明 在ArcGIS中通过SDE存储空间数据到Oracle中有多种存储方式,分别有:二进制Long Raw .ESRI的ST_Geometry以及 ...

  9. Oracle 语句中“||”代表什么啊?

    Oracle 语句中“||”代表什么啊? Oracle 语句中“||”代表什么啊?跟ServerSQL中的字符串的连接符“+”是一个概念么? 1. 恩是的 是一个含义...select '1'||'2 ...

随机推荐

  1. Linux下基于.NET5开发CAX应用

    <<.NET5下的三维应用程序开发>>一文中介绍了如何在.NET5下使用AnyCAD开发应用程序.相比.NET4.x,.NET5一大进步便是可以跨平台,即可以在Linux.Ma ...

  2. git+pycharm结合使用

    Pycharm + git 进行结合使用 第一步:Pycharm配置本地安装的Git 测试框架的负责人: 编写好一套能用的基础框架代码 --- > 上传到公司远程仓库 --- 设置团队协作成员 ...

  3. 十、TestNG分组测试

    使用 groups 属性 package com.lc.tesgFenZu; import org.testng.annotations.AfterGroups; import org.testng. ...

  4. hydra-microservice 中文手册(3W字预警)

    Hydras 是什么? Hydra 是一个 NodeJS 包(技术栈不是重点,思想!思想!思想!),它有助于构建分布式应用程序,比如微服务. Hydra 提供服务发现(service discover ...

  5. 一文带你彻底了解大数据处理引擎Flink内存管理

    摘要: Flink是jvm之上的大数据处理引擎. Flink是jvm之上的大数据处理引擎,jvm存在java对象存储密度低.full gc时消耗性能,gc存在stw的问题,同时omm时会影响稳定性.同 ...

  6. Java进阶专题(十九) 消息中间件架构体系(1)-- ActiveMQ研究

    前言 MQ全称为Message Queue,即消息队列,它是一种应用程序之间的通信方法,消息队列在分布式系统开 发中应用非常广泛.开发中消息队列通常有如下应用场景:1.任务异步处理.将不需要同步处理的 ...

  7. 洛谷题解 P1051 【谁拿了最多奖学金】

    其实很水 链接: P1051 [谁拿了最多奖学金] 注意: 看好信息,不要看漏或看错因为信息很密集 AC代码: 1 #include<bits/stdc++.h>//头文件 2 using ...

  8. Spark-4-为何要处理数据倾斜

    什么是数据倾斜 对Spark/Hadoop这样的大数据系统来讲,数据量大并不可怕,可怕的是数据倾斜. 何谓数据倾斜?数据倾斜指的是,并行处理的数据集中,某一部分(如Spark或Kafka的一个Part ...

  9. Google、Facebook等均开始支持的HTTP3到底是个什么鬼?

    GitHub 19k Star 的Java工程师成神之路,不来了解一下吗! 最近一段时间以来,关于HTTP/3的新闻有很多,越来越多的国际大公司已经开始使用HTTP/3了. 所以,HTTP/3已经是箭 ...

  10. 【k8s实战一】Jenkins 部署应用到 Kubernetes

    [k8s实战一]Jenkins 部署应用到 Kubernetes 01 本文主旨 目标是演示整个Jenkins从源码构建镜像到部署镜像到Kubernetes集群过程. 为了简化流程与容易重现文中效果, ...